|  | #include "SampleCode.h" | 
|  | #include "SkCanvas.h" | 
|  | #include "SkDevice.h" | 
|  |  | 
|  | namespace { | 
|  | SkBitmap make_bitmap() { | 
|  | SkBitmap bm; | 
|  | bm.setConfig(SkBitmap::kARGB_8888_Config , 5, 5); | 
|  | bm.allocPixels(); | 
|  |  | 
|  | for (int y = 0; y < bm.height(); y++) { | 
|  | uint32_t* p = bm.getAddr32(0, y); | 
|  | for (int x = 0; x < bm.width(); x++) { | 
|  | p[x] = ((x + y) & 1) ? SK_ColorWHITE : SK_ColorBLACK; | 
|  | } | 
|  | } | 
|  | bm.unlockPixels(); | 
|  | return bm; | 
|  | } | 
|  | } // unnamed namespace | 
|  |  | 
|  | class TextureDomainView : public SampleView { | 
|  | SkBitmap    fBM; | 
|  |  | 
|  | public: | 
|  | TextureDomainView(){ | 
|  | fBM = make_bitmap(); | 
|  | } | 
|  |  | 
|  | protected: | 
|  | // overrides from SkEventSink | 
|  | virtual bool onQuery(SkEvent* evt) { | 
|  | if (SampleCode::TitleQ(*evt)) { | 
|  | SampleCode::TitleR(evt, "Texture Domian"); | 
|  | return true; | 
|  | } | 
|  | return this->INHERITED::onQuery(evt); | 
|  | } | 
|  |  | 
|  | virtual void onDrawContent(SkCanvas* canvas) { | 
|  | SkIRect srcRect; | 
|  | SkRect dstRect; | 
|  | SkPaint paint; | 
|  | paint.setFilterBitmap(true); | 
|  |  | 
|  | // Test that bitmap draws from malloc-backed bitmaps respect | 
|  | // the constrained texture domain. | 
|  | srcRect.setXYWH(1, 1, 3, 3); | 
|  | dstRect.setXYWH(5.0f, 5.0f, 305.0f, 305.0f); | 
|  | canvas->drawBitmapRect(fBM, &srcRect, dstRect, &paint); | 
|  |  | 
|  | // Test that bitmap draws across separate devices also respect | 
|  | // the constrainted texture domain. | 
|  | // Note:  GPU-backed bitmaps follow a different rendering path | 
|  | // when copying from one GPU device to another. | 
|  | SkRefPtr<SkDevice> primaryDevice(canvas->getDevice()); | 
|  | SkRefPtr<SkDevice> secondDevice(canvas->createDevice( | 
|  | SkBitmap::kARGB_8888_Config, 5, 5, true, true)); | 
|  | secondDevice->unref(); | 
|  | SkCanvas secondCanvas(secondDevice.get()); | 
|  |  | 
|  | srcRect.setXYWH(1, 1, 3, 3); | 
|  | dstRect.setXYWH(1.0f, 1.0f, 3.0f, 3.0f); | 
|  | secondCanvas.drawBitmapRect(fBM, &srcRect, dstRect, &paint); | 
|  |  | 
|  | SkBitmap deviceBitmap = secondDevice->accessBitmap(false); | 
|  |  | 
|  | srcRect.setXYWH(1, 1, 3, 3); | 
|  | dstRect.setXYWH(405.0f, 5.0f, 305.0f, 305.0f); | 
|  | canvas->drawBitmapRect(deviceBitmap, &srcRect, dstRect, &paint); | 
|  | } | 
|  | private: | 
|  | typedef SkView INHERITED; | 
|  | }; | 
|  |  | 
|  | ////////////////////////////////////////////////////////////////////////////// | 
|  |  | 
|  | static SkView* MyFactory() { return new TextureDomainView; } | 
|  | static SkViewRegister reg(MyFactory); |
